Impact hub FAQs
What is in our Impact Hub?
Our regularly updated Impact Hub contains information and data on:
- The needs we address and the evidence-base for the approaches we take.
- Our work with organisations and services across Sheffield, and the wider context of work that we are a part of.
- Ways in which we can assess the impact of our shared work in Sheffield as a whole, and the role we play within this.
How often do we report on the difference we make?
Until 2023 we published an Impact Report annually, undertaking additional project reporting as required by our funders.
In November 2023, we decided to take a different approach to understanding and reporting on the difference we make. Our Impact Hub supports us to learn and report on a regular basis, and allows us to share more transparently, regularly, and widely.
